The ‘Short sell’ is a term utilized in many property circles, and the short sale of your house is a last ditch effort to stop foreclosure. Possibly to worst thing that could occur, isn’t having the ability to look after your dues, and this is one of those things that in some worst case examples folks have taken their own lives. It is sorrowful pondering having your house go into foreclosure, losing your automobile, and it’s no ask why so many get unhappy.

If you’re looking at foreclosure and do not know what to do, there are some options you may use to protect you from bankruptcy or having a massive fat black spot on your credit. It is known as the short sale. It is largely giving up your house for the sum you owe, and walking away from your debt. If you owe more than your house is worth, then your banks will need to accept your house and take the loss.

Now this is something that could be a time-consuming process, and you’ll have to open and spill your courage out to folk who are not your folks. In the long term, it’s better than having a foreclosure or bankruptcy on your record, and could even save your credit history. If you’re about to do this, you must start as fast as you can, and these are some things that will help you.

First thing you should do is educate yourself on what a short sale is and how much is concerned. A way to do this is to take a seat with a Realtor who’s competent in the short sell process. The more experienced they are and particularly if you know them, they can act as a liaison between you and your banks. They can also help you with all of the calculations, like what your debt is on your residence compared to its price, as well as any other debt against it.

Since each state has different laws about foreclosure, it’s a smart idea to start right away, or you can lose your chance. Sit down and write your banks a difficulty letter, and you’ve got to be formal about it, just explain the situation in detail why the short sell of your house is the sole option, and be truthful. When you’re done, ensure that you have all of the important papers stating the situation too so your lenders will know a short sale is your best and only course.

Be prepared both physically and emotional to move swiftly. Have your stuff packed and either moved into storage, or prepared to move into a rental. Walk through your home, and let go off your feelings, and say your goodbyes. Get down to the basic living essentials, and that is it. You’ll only have a brief period of time in which the fast sales will occur and you’ll have to move at a second’s notice.

Achieving The Short Refinance

Posted by: Raynard Nestor | Comments (0)

When your place is in difficulty you have to do all that you can to make certain that you don’t go into foreclosure. Yes it is easy to just give up, but it appears to be terrible on your credit if you manage to lose your house in that way. Luckily there are some other choices that you can take merit of so you don’t finish up in more debt. One thing that you can do is choose a short refinance.

This is a lot like a short sell, but it enables you to stay within your house instead of being compelled to leave it. Fundamentally what occurs is you pay off your loan quickly and doubtless for a lower amount than normal. It sounds great, but in truth you’ll just be starting another loan process.

It sounds unbelievable but there are an increasing number of lenders accepting this considering the dropping value rate of homes everywhere. It might not have been possible for you several years ago, but now it’s a real option. So perhaps you should learn about a few of the steps that are going to be required of you before you actually make this work.

it might take you some calls or long hold times to eventually find the person in charge of approving the short refinance, but persistence always pays off! When you get in contact with the best person, ask if they can offer you a short refinance. In the event that they approve it you want to recollect who you chatted with, write down their name and telephone number in the event the lending company develops a bout of absentmindedness.

The company will customarily have an internet application for you to fill out, so you will have to do that. There also will be some physical paperwork to fill out, so learn about it along the path ; you do not need to miss a single detail. The short refinance could be a difficult process, but if it implies you get to keep your place it is extremely profitable.

When you get your new loan agreement, you can go on and submit your short refinance request. This is generally a fast loan, and may be closed in only one week assuming your bank accepts it. Naturally there’s a likelihood that your bank will flat out say no, and this is something you will have to be prepared for.

This isn’t exactly an orthodox method and it may be very complicated. Still it’s much better than going into foreclosure any day. If you feel you are in danger then check with your lender to see if a short refinance is possible. It may be the best decision you ever make!

Short Sale vs Foreclosure

Posted by: Roy Aylmer | Comments (0)

In the short sale vs foreclosure comparison, it is important to look at how these two processes work. If you own a home, and stop making payments on it, the lender will begin the foreclosure process, in as little as six to eight weeks after your missed payment. If this occurs, you may need to fight the foreclosure using what is called a short sale. If your only options are a short sale or foreclosure, a short sale is often the better route to take since it offers some protection to your credit. But, what is this?

Short Sale Defined: A short sale is a situation in which you sell your home for less than what is owed on your current home loan. For example, if your home is in foreclosure and you owe your lender a total of $150,000 on the property on a mortgage, the lender could foreclose on the property and then have to deal with trying to sell the property. Your personal credit would be destroyed in this process since you walked away from the loan. To avoid this, you find a buyer who is willing to purchase the home from you. The problem is, the buyer does not want to pay full price. He agrees to pay $125,000 instead.

In a short sale agreement, the bank agrees to accept the lower payment as payment in full for the loan. You are forgiven for the loan in total and your buyer purchases the property for the concluded on cost. In this example of a short sale vs foreclosure, the most obvious benefit is that your credit isn’t devastated in the short sale. Nonetheless , you may still lose your place

You may be able to get the lender to agree to a short refinance, where the lender will refinance the loan at the lower price and keep you on as the borrower. In a short refinance, a portion of the value of the home is forgiven, which helps to lower the money payments, making it easier for you to make payments.

If you’re a good borrower, and something has occurred that has caused you to enter into the battle of short sale vs foreclosure, the best move to make is to work with your bank to get a solution. A short sale could be a good answer, as would a short refinance. In either situation, you don’t need to have the negative impact of a foreclosure on your credit score. Bother to discover what all your options are before you agree to a short sale or any sort of foreclosure.

As the economy continues to paste in this slow down, folk are still trying hard to make it day by day, which is leading to an increase in the necessity for a short refi or short sell. This economy makes it particularly challenging for householders to keep current on their mortgage and stop foreclosure. In a number of cases, regardless of the best efforts, a householder could find themselves facing the chance of foreclosure. There are things a home-owner can do to help stop this from taking place and protect their investment. 2 options are a short refi or a short sell.

Reduce your debts : A short refi is a refinance of your present mortgage. You take out a new loan to repay your current loan. This new loan has new terms, probably a lower rate of interest or the power to extend your loan length. This permits you to keep your house and finish up owing less on the home as you are refinancing at your houses currents worth, you are getting a new IR and you are potentially also extending the length

Essentially , a short refi is a short sell of your house back to you. Instead of you selling the home to somebody else, your bank simply restructured a loan and repays the higher existing loan so you can now stay in your house. Now, though , you have reduced payments which make it reasonable, permitting you to avoid foreclosure

Cautions of a Refinance : naturally, you can’t forget that refinancing of any type incorporates risks and drawbacks. A short refi or maybe a short sell is a settlement by your bank on the present loan. Your bank takes the profit cut because they’re paying down what you owe now, which is more than the amount you’ll refinance at. This leaves a bit of money which will never be repaid. The bank deals with this by charging it off as a delinquent debt.

When the bank does this charge off, they can potentially report this to the credit companies. Your credit will be adversely impacted. This charge off will appear as a delinquent debt. It is easily worth weighing your options to make sure that a short refi is the best choice, considering the damage to your credit.
